Why Your Skype ID Matters

Your Skype ID is often the first impression people have of you online. It’s a unique identifier that sets you apart from others and makes it easy for friends, family, colleagues, and clients to find and connect with you. A well-chosen Skype ID can:

  • Enhance your online presence: A professional-sounding Skype ID can make you appear more credible and trustworthy.
  • Simplify communication: A memorable Skype ID makes it easy for others to find and contact you.
  • Boost your personal brand: A unique and creative Skype ID can help you stand out and showcase your personality.

Brainstorming Ideas for Your Skype ID

Before we dive into the dos and don’ts of creating a Skype ID, let’s explore some ideas to get you started:

Nama-based IDs

Using a variation of your name is a popular choice for many Skype users. This approach is simple and straightforward, making it easy for others to find and remember you. Consider using a combination of your first and last name, or a nickname that’s closely associated with you.

Interest-based IDs

If you have a specific hobby or interest, consider incorporating it into your Skype ID. This approach can help you connect with like-minded individuals and Showcase your personality.

Professional IDs

If you’re using Skype for business purposes, it’s essential to have a professional-sounding ID. Consider using your company name, job title, or a combination of your name and profession.

Dos and Don’ts of Creating a Skype ID

Now that we’ve explored some ideas, let’s discuss the dos and don’ts of creating a Skype ID:

Do:

  • Keep it simple and memorable: Avoid using complex words or phrases that are difficult to spell or remember.
  • Make it unique: Avoid using common words or phrases that may be already taken by someone else.
  • Use a consistent tone: If you’re using your Skype ID for business purposes, ensure it’s professional-sounding and consistent with your brand.

Don’t:

  • Avoid using numbers and special characters unnecessarily: While numbers and special characters can make your ID more unique, they can also make it harder to remember and type.
  • Don’t use offensive or inappropriate language: Remember that your Skype ID is a representation of you online, so ensure it’s respectful and professional.
  • Avoid using temporary or trendy IDs: Your Skype ID should be a long-term investment, so avoid using IDs that may become outdated or unfashionable.

How do I come up with a unique Skype ID?

Coming up with a unique Skype ID requires some creativity and brainstorming. You can start by thinking about your name, nickname, or a combination of letters and words that reflect your personality or profession. You can also try using a phrase or a quote that inspires you, or a word that’s meaningful to you. Another approach is to use a combination of letters and numbers, or a mix of uppercase and lowercase letters to create a unique ID.

Remember to keep your Skype ID short, memorable, and easy to spell. Avoid using special characters or numbers if possible, as they can be hard to remember or type. You can also try using an online username generator to get inspiration for your Skype ID. Whatever approach you choose, make sure your Skype ID is unique, easy to remember, and reflects your personality or brand.

How do I make my Skype ID more discoverable?

Making your Skype ID more discoverable can help you connect with others who share similar interests or professions. One way to do this is to use keywords related to your profession or hobby in your Skype ID. For instance, if you’re a freelance writer, you could use a Skype ID like “WordWeaver” or “ContentCreator”. This can help others find you when searching for keywords related to your profession.

Another way to make your Skype ID more discoverable is to use a consistent branding across all your social media profiles. This can help you build a strong online presence and make it easier for others to find and connect with you. You can also join Skype groups related to your profession or interest, which can help you connect with like-minded individuals and grow your network.
